For the experimental school in Stockholm Bureau Rosan Bosch has created interiors conducive to easily and naturally assimilate knowledge. Even inveterate idlers and Losers, getting them into this school, visited him with pleasure.





Total in Sweden there are about 30 such "school of free education."





The peculiarity of the system of training Vittra (exactly two Vittra c tt, and not the one, how to spell the name of the well-known brand of furniture) is that children do not separate items, and address specific learning situations that require knowledge of all sorts.



Accordingly, students are not divided into classes and groups, based on their personal characteristics, aptitudes and scope of basic skills.



The area of ​​the school is about 1,900 sq.m. There is no conventional classes with tables and chairs.



The space rich interior object organic form - "Ice Mountain", "tree", "cave", "The Island."



So-called laboratory - a zone intended for study and dialogue in small groups of 3-4 people. Between them there is no deaf walls themselves are zoned furniture elements. In schools Vittra widely used digital technology and, of course, this should be reflected in the design.



For example, popular with students enjoying the green island object intended for working on lap-tops.



On the benches of the following construction, "Ice Mountain", comfortable to sit and chat in a relaxed atmosphere.



Thus, the interior design has truly become an additional tool for education. The main materials of the architects chose a tree, plywood, linoleum, carpet and soundproofing panels.
